Scrappy but Successful [Consultant's Personalities When No One's Watching]
Beata Rouleau is the founder of Compass Consulting, a fractional COO practice that helps tech companies between $1M and $20M in revenue build the strategies, systems, and automations that turn plans into predictable growth. She grew up in a family of six kids and lifelong entrepreneurs, was homeschooled, and worked her way from executive assistant to COO before launching Compass two years ago. In this episode, Jack and Beata dig into scrappy LinkedIn outreach that actually works, why she keeps her overhead lean, and the one thing every founder needs to rally a team around a single goal.
